Hi, Sorry for not paying closer attention to this. I actually had forgotten about that page. I've removed all references to nabble from the /search/index.html page. I agree we probably need a better search mechanism, but I don't know what it is.
-derek PS: I reached out to my colleagues at the IETF who migrated from MM2 to MM3, and they confirmed my fears. They spent a ton of $$$ to contract out to get the migration done. It did NOT go smoothly. They had to implement customer scripts to perform the migration, and had to add custom code to MM3 to get it up to snuff. Most of that code is NOT publicly available.
